CRIMSON FAIRY BOOK and VIOLET FAIRY BOOK

This follows the revision made a number of years ago in the other titles in this series. The Blue, Red, Green and Yellow Fairy Books were revised and given and clearer type. Now these two have been added. These books which have collected the folk lore of every nation may have a new vitality today. The Crimson represents Finnish, Hungarian, Russian, Serbian, Rumanian, Japanese, Sicilian, Italian and Tuniel folktales, is illustrated with 8 color plates by Ben Kutcher and has a foreward by Gould Davis. The Violet emphasizes the tales from Slavic countries, and is illustrated with 8 color plates by Dorothy Lake Gregory. Librarians and children will be happy to see these old favorites, back on the shelves, in their new dress and pictures.
